Azheke Village and Mushroom Houses in Yuanyang Couty, Honghe

Chinese Name: 红河州元阳县新街镇爱春村委会阿者科村

English Name: Azheke Village of Xinjie Town in Yuanyang County, Honghe

Azheke Village (阿者科村) is situated in Xinjie Town, within the Aichun Village Committee (爱春村委会), approximately 28 kilometers from Xinjie Town (新街镇). The primary sources of income for the villagers are agriculture and animal husbandry, with the fertile land of the region providing ample opportunities for both activities.

The Location and Cultural Significance of Azheke Village

Azheke Village lies deep within the Yuanyang (元阳) terraced landscape, renowned as a UNESCO World Heritage site. The village is part of the Hani (哈尼) ethnic stockade villages and is home to more than 60 households. The Hani terraces, with a history spanning over a thousand years, are a significant cultural and agricultural treasure of the Hani people. These terraces are among the most iconic features of Yuanyang and showcase the harmonious relationship between the local population and their environment.

Traditional Mushroom-Shaped Housing

One of the most striking aspects of Azheke Village is its unique mushroom-shaped thatched houses. These traditional dwellings are built with local materials such as bamboo, wood, and thatch, and their design is adapted to the natural environment. The rounded mushroom shape is both practical and symbolic, reflecting the villagers’ deep respect for nature and the balance between architecture and the surrounding landscape.

These houses are strategically placed on the mountainside, creating a picturesque and harmonious environment where the village, terraces, river, and forests coexist. The villagers rely on mountain spring water for both their daily lives and agricultural activities, further reinforcing the eco-friendly and sustainable nature of the community.

A Unique Ecological Stockade Village

Azheke is an extraordinary example of an eco-village that has remained largely unchanged for centuries. The village’s architectural and agricultural practices are deeply embedded in the natural surroundings, and the community continues to use traditional methods that reflect a profound connection with the land. The village’s location, surrounded by terraced fields, forests, and mountains, is a testament to the villagers’ resourcefulness and respect for their environment.

In 2013, when the Hani Terraces were inscribed as a UNESCO World Heritage site, Azheke was one of the five villages included in the declaration, with a population of around 400 people. This recognition highlights the village’s cultural importance and its role in preserving the heritage of the Hani people.

A Popular Destination for Tourists and Filmmakers

Azheke Village attracts a steady stream of domestic and international tourists, particularly between November and April. The village’s scenic beauty, rich cultural heritage, and traditional lifestyle make it an appealing destination for those looking to experience an authentic rural environment. In addition to its cultural and natural significance, Azheke also served as a filming location for the 2018 movie Forever Young (《无问西东》), further raising the village’s profile.

Visitors to Azheke can enjoy the stunning views of the terraces, cloud-covered mountains, and misty landscapes, all while learning about the history and traditions of the Hani people. The villagers are known for their warmth and hospitality, and it is common for tourists to sit with the elderly residents, hear stories about village life, and gain insights into the region’s long-standing agricultural practices.

Cultural Education in Azheke Village

The educational needs of Azheke’s younger residents are met by local schools. Elementary school students attend the Aichun Elementary School (爱春), while middle school students travel to Shengcun Village (胜村), located 1.5 kilometers from the elementary school. Currently, there are 39 elementary students and 14 middle school students enrolled in the village’s educational system.

How to Get to Azheke Village in Yuanyang County, Honghe

There are several transportation options for reaching Azheke Village, including self-driving, high-speed train, and chartered vehicles.

1. Self-Driving:

  • Route: From Kunming, drive along the Kunming-Mohan Expressway (昆磨高速) and the Yongjin Expressway (永金高速), which takes about 5 hours. This route is smooth and hassle-free.
  • Alternative Route: You can also take the Chengyuan Expressway (呈元高速) and National Highway 245 (245国道), but the latter part of the journey consists of winding mountain roads, which can be challenging, especially in the rainy season due to fog. This route requires higher driving skills.

2. By High-Speed Train:

  • Step 1: Fly into Kunming Changshui International Airport.
  • Step 2: From the airport, take a bus to Yuanyang County, which takes approximately 4 to 5 hours.
  • Step 3: Once in Yuanyang, you can either take a tourist bus or rent a car to reach Azheke Village, which takes another 2 hours.

3. Charter a Vehicle:

  • Pick-up: You can charter a vehicle from either Mengzi Railway Station (蒙自火车站) or Honghe Railway Station (红河站).
  • Cost: The chartered vehicle price is approximately 500 RMB for a private car, or around 120 RMB per person for a shared ride. The journey takes about 3 to 4 hours, but it’s best to arrange the vehicle in advance through local accommodations or tour services.

4. Parking at Azheke Village:

  • Upon arrival at Azheke Village, there is a small parking lot at the village entrance, which can accommodate about 20 vehicles and offers free parking. However, if you arrive late, you may need to park outside the village and walk in.
